Members of Parliament to get Ipads Today

Deputy Speaker Jacob Oulanyah has confirmed that Members of Parliament will start receiving their Ipads today.
 
Parliament spent Sh1.9 billion for the Ipads in addition to over 86 billion shillings for cars that are to be given to the 431 members.
Free Ipads for law makers were first introduced in 2013 with an aim of reducing parliament’s expenditure on stationary mainly on purchase of paper for printing documents to be presented in the House.
